Job Description

Position Title: Senior Business Analyst

The organization seeks a Senior Business Analyst to identify and evaluate opportunities for business growth. This role involves analyzing data, constructing financial models, and translating insights into actionable recommendations for leadership. The position requires a strong understanding of accounting principles and a collaborative approach to work closely with the CFO and Controller. Candidates should be prepared to navigate the challenges of establishing processes in a newly created role. The ideal candidate will contribute to strategic decision-making while supporting the company’s continued growth and development.

Senior Business Analyst Responsibilities:

  • Work with leaders to define business opportunities and success metrics
  • Analyze internal and external data, including market trends and competition
  • Build financial models, such as NPV and IRR
  • Perform scenario and “what-if” analyses to support decision-making
  • Turn analysis into clear summaries and recommendations for leadership
  • Identify growth opportunities and cost-saving initiatives
  • Research revenue opportunities using vendors and industry data
  • Create dashboards and reports to track performance
  • Prepare materials for leadership and board meetings
  • Present findings and recommendations clearly and effectively
  • Maintain documentation of models and data sources
  • Support proposal and investment documentation
  • Track timelines and deliverables for business cases
  • Coordinate with Finance, Legal, and Compliance teams as needed
  • Maintain confidentiality of sensitive data
  • Support budgeting and strategic planning processes
  • Travel as needed for meetings or presentations
  • Follow all company policies and safety standards

Senior Business Analyst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, or a related field
  • 3–7+ years of experience, with a strong accounting background
  • Advanced Excel proficiency is required
  • Experience with MS Office (Word, Teams)
  • Manufacturing industry experience is required
  • Agricultural manufacturing or ethanol experience is preferred
  • Experience with data tools, such as Power BI, is preferred
